    Lofton Remembers Nailgun

    The Nail Gun Massacre: Interview with Terry Lofton (2014)

    *** 1/2 (out of 4)

    This 16-minute interview has Terry Lofton discussing his cult film THE NAIL GUN MASSACRE. There was a previous featurette called NAILED that had Lofton talking about the film and his career but this one here certainly goes into more details. A wide range of subjects are discussed including his claim that the humor in the film was done on purpose because he realized that he just wasn't going to be able to scare anyone horror wise. From here he talks about the various video people who stole money from him or how they'd try to make the expenses look a lot worse than they were so that they wouldn't have to pay him any money. He even calls out a couple companies, which I'm surprised was left in the featurette. He also talks about the rise of "fame" or notoriety. Fans of the movie, which there are plenty, are going to have a good time with this interview with Lofton has always come across as a fun guy and he obviously enjoys talking about the film.
